Benefits of Installing an Air Humidifier

Having a working humidifier in your home can provide more than just comfort. It’s easier to catch illnesses when your home is constantly too dry. The mucus membranes in your nose are the first line of defense against airborne illnesses, and they require a constant stream of humidification in the air in order to work properly.

Without humidity in your Colorado Springs, CO, home during the winter, you’ll be dealing with an uncomfortable disposition as well as a higher chance of contracting illnesses like the common cold or the flu.
